Как обратиться к ячейке на другом листе в Excel: подробный гайд

Microsoft Excel — это мощный инструмент для работы с таблицами и данных. Возможность обращения к ячейкам на разных листах крайне полезна при выполнении сложных расчетов или создании сводных таблиц. В этой статье мы поговорим о том, как правильно обратиться к ячейке, находящейся на другом листе в Excel.

Один из самых простых способов обратиться к ячейке на другом листе — это использовать ссылку на лист. Для этого нужно указать название листа, за которым следует восклицательный знак, а затем указать адрес ячейки. Например, если нужно обратиться к ячейке A1 на листе «Лист2», то запись будет выглядеть так: ‘Лист2’!A1.

Также можно использовать функцию INDIRECT для обращения к ячейке на другом листе. Функция INDIRECT позволяет обращаться к ячейкам с использованием текстового значения или формулы, что делает ее очень гибкой и мощной. Для обращения к ячейке через функцию INDIRECT нужно указать «адрес» ячейки в виде строки. Например, INDIRECT(«Лист2!A1») вернет значение ячейки A1 на листе «Лист2».

Независимо от выбранного способа, обращение к ячейке на другом листе в Excel — это полезная функция, которая поможет вам работать с данными и создавать сложные расчеты в своих таблицах.

Как обратиться к ячейке на другом листе Excel?

В Excel можно создавать несколько листов в одном файле, что позволяет логически разделять данные и облегчает их организацию. Если вы хотите получить доступ к данных из ячейки на другом листе, то в Excel есть несколько способов для этого.

1. Использование имени листа:

Для того чтобы обратиться к ячейке на другом листе, можно использовать имя листа в формуле. Начните формулу с символа «=», затем укажите имя листа, в котором находится ячейка, используя одинарные кавычки, например:

=Лист2!A1

В этом примере мы обратились к ячейке A1 на листе «Лист2».

2. Использование ссылки на лист:

Другим способом является использование ссылки на лист в формуле. Для этого напишите символ «=» и выберите ячейку, в которой требуется получить ссылку на лист. Затем выберите нужный лист и ячейку на нем. Например:

='Лист2'!A1

Excel автоматически создаст ссылку на нужный лист и ячейку на нем.

3. Использование функций:

В Excel также существуют функции, которые позволяют обратиться к ячейке на другом листе. Например, функция INDIRECT позволяет обратиться к ячейке, используя текстовое значение с ссылкой на нужный лист и ячейку.

=INDIRECT("Лист2!A1")

Эта функция возвращает значение ячейки A1 на листе «Лист2».

В результате вы сможете получить данные из ячейки на другом листе и использовать их в своих формулах или анализе данных.

Определение листа

В Excel каждый лист представляет собой отдельную вкладку в рабочей книге. Чтобы обратиться к ячейке на другом листе, сначала нужно определить этот лист.

В Excel можно использовать несколько способов для определения листа:

  1. По имени листа: каждый лист может иметь свое уникальное имя, которое можно использовать для обращения к нему. Имя листа обычно отображается на вкладке с этим листом внизу окна Excel. Например, если лист называется «Sheet1», можно обратиться к ячейке на этом листе с помощью формулы: =Sheet1!A1.
  2. По порядковому номеру: каждый лист имеет порядковый номер, начиная с 1. Можно использовать порядковый номер для обращения к листу. Например, если нужно обратиться к ячейке на втором листе, можно использовать формулу: =Sheet2!A1.

В Excel также доступны специальные функции для работы с листами:

  • СТР: функция СТР возвращает имя листа с указанным номером. Например, формула =СТР(2) вернет имя второго листа.
  • ИНДЕКС: функция ИНДЕКС возвращает ссылку на ячейку на указанном листе с помощью его имени или порядкового номера. Например, формула =ИНДЕКС(Sheet1!A1:B2, 1, 2) вернет значение ячейки B1 на листе Sheet1.

Используйте эти способы для определения листа в Excel и обращайтесь к ячейкам на нужных вам листах.

Обращение к ячейке

В Excel существует возможность обращаться к ячейкам на другом листе для получения данных или выполнения операций с ними. Для этого используются специальные формулы и ссылки.

Формула для обращения к ячейке на другом листе имеет следующий синтаксис:

=SheetName!CellAddress

Где:

  • SheetName — название листа, на который ссылается формула;
  • CellAddress — адрес ячейки, к которой нужно обратиться.

Например, если ячейка A1 на листе «Лист2» содержит значение 10, чтобы получить это значение на текущем листе, нужно использовать формулу:

=Лист2!A1

Результатом данной формулы будет число 10.

Также можно использовать ячейки на других листах в рамках других формул. Например, можно выполнить сложение значений ячеек на разных листах:

На «Лист1» в ячейке A1 содержится значение 5, на «Лист2» в ячейке A1 содержится значение 10. Чтобы получить сумму этих значений, можно использовать формулу:

=Лист1!A1+Лист2!A1

Результатом данной формулы будет число 15.

Также можно использовать обращение к ячейке на другом листе в рамках условных операторов, функций и других формул. Например, можно сделать проверку значения ячейки на «Лист2» и выполнить определенное действие в зависимости от результата проверки:

=IF(Лист2!A1 > 10, "Больше 10", "Меньше или равно 10")

В данном примере выполняется проверка значения ячейки A1 на «Лист2». Если оно больше 10, то возвращается текст «Больше 10», иначе возвращается текст «Меньше или равно 10».

Обращение к ячейке на другом листе позволяет работать с данными на разных листах в рамках одного файла Excel и упрощает выполнение операций с ними.

Примеры использования

  • Пример 1:

    Предположим, что в Excel у нас есть два листа: «Лист1» и «Лист2». На «Лист1» у нас есть ячейка A1 со значением «Привет!». Чтобы обратиться к этой ячейке из «Лист2», используется следующая формула:

    =Лист1!A1

    Это означает, что мы обращаемся к ячейке A1 на листе «Лист1».

  • Пример 2:

    У нас есть две ячейки: A1 на «Лист1» и B2 на «Лист2». Мы хотим сослаться на ячейку A1 и сложить ее со значением ячейки B2. Формула для этого будет выглядеть так:

    =Лист1!A1 + Лист2!B2

    Это означает, что мы обращаемся к ячейке A1 на «Лист1» и ячейке B2 на «Лист2», а затем складываем значения этих ячеек.

  • Пример 3:

    Допустим, что у нас есть две ячейки: A1 на «Лист1» и C3 на «Лист2». Мы хотим умножить значение ячейки A1 на значение ячейки C3. Формула для этого будет выглядеть так:

    =Лист1!A1 * Лист2!C3

    Это означает, что мы обращаемся к ячейке A1 на «Лист1» и ячейке C3 на «Лист2», а затем умножаем значения этих ячеек.

Вопрос-ответ

Как обратиться к ячейке на другом листе Excel?

Для обращения к ячейке на другом листе в Excel, вам понадобится использовать ссылку на это место. Например, чтобы обратиться к ячейке A1 на листе «Лист2», вы можете использовать формулу «=Лист2!A1».

Как указать диапазон ячеек на другом листе Excel?

Для указания диапазона ячеек на другом листе в Excel, вам также понадобится использовать ссылку на этот лист. Например, чтобы указать диапазон A1:B5 на листе «Лист2», вы можете использовать формулу «=Лист2!A1:B5».

Можно ли обратиться к ячейке на другом листе по имени?

Да, в Excel вы можете назначить имена для ячеек и обратиться к ним на другом листе. Для этого вам понадобится использовать формулу вида «=Имя_листа!Имя_ячейки». Например, если вы назвали ячейку A1 на листе «Лист2» как «Имя_ячейки», то формула будет выглядеть так: «=Лист2!Имя_ячейки».

Как обратиться к ячейкам на других листах с помощью VBA?

В VBA (Visual Basic for Applications) для обращения к ячейкам на других листах в Excel используется объект «Worksheets». Например, чтобы прочитать содержимое ячейки A1 на листе «Лист2» и записать его в переменную «value», вы можете использовать следующий код: «value = Worksheets(«Лист2»).Range(«A1″).Value».

Оцените статью
uchet-jkh.ru